William Blair Investment Management LLC increased its stake in Alignment Healthcare, Inc. (NASDAQ:ALHC – Free Report) by 8.7% during the 4th quarter, according to its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The firm owned 2,305,255 shares of the company’s stock after buying an additional 185,303 shares during the period. William Blair Investment Management LLC’s holdings in Alignment Healthcare were worth $45,529,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Insider Transactions at Alignment Healthcare
In other news, CEO John E. Kao sold 298,000 shares of the firm’s stock in a transaction dated Monday, May 11th. The shares were sold at an average price of $16.89, for a total value of $5,033,220.00. Following the sale, the chief executive officer directly owned 1,508,641 shares in the company, valued at approximately $25,480,946.49. This trade represents a 16.49% decrease in their position. Alignment Healthcare Stock Performance
NASDAQ ALHC opened at $16.35 on Monday.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 1.56, a quick ratio of 1.58 and a current ratio of 1.58. The company has a market capitalization of $3.38 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 181.67,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 2.29 and a beta of 1.26. The company’s 50-day simple moving average is $18.84 and its two-hundred day simple moving average is $19.43. Alignment Healthcare, Inc. has a one year low of $11.63 and a one year high of $23.87.
Alignment Healthcare (NASDAQ:ALHC – Get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Thursday, April 30th. The company reported $0.05 EPS for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.01 by $0.04. The business had revenue of $1.24 billion for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$1.22 billion. Alignment Healthcare had a net margin of 0.47% and a return on equity of 11.50%. The company’s revenue for the quarter was up 33.3% on a year-over-year basis. During the same quarter last year, the firm posted ($0.05) EPS. Equities analysts forecast that Alignment Healthcare, Inc. will post 0.19 EPS for the current fiscal year.
About Alignment Healthcare
Alignment Healthcare, Inc (NASDAQ: ALHC) is a health care company specializing in value-based care for Medicare Advantage beneficiaries. The company leverages an integrated care model that combines in-home clinical services, telehealth capabilities and digital health tools to manage chronic conditions, improve outcomes and enhance patient experience.
At the core of Alignment Healthcare’s approach is a proprietary technology platform that aggregates real-time clinical and claims data to support preventive care, risk stratification and personalized care plans.
